东南教育网您的位置:首页 >科技 >

linux怎么看当前用户有无root权限(linux判断当前用户是否是root)

导读 1、判断当前用户是否是根2、复制代码3、代码如下:4、 -根用户检查-开始5、if [` id-u `- ne];然后6、回应"请以根用户身份重新

1、判断当前用户是否是根

2、复制代码

3、代码如下:

4、# -根用户检查-开始

5、if [` id-u `- ne];然后

6、回应"请以根用户身份重新运行${this_file}”

7、出口/p

8、船方不负担装货费用

9、# -根用户检查-结束

10、if[x ' $ USER '=x ' '];然后

11、如果id | grep '^uid=root)'/dev/null;然后

12、:

13、其他

14、回声'请以根用户身份重新运行basename $ '

15、出口/p

16、船方不负担装货费用

17、其他

18、如果[!x ' $ USER '=x ' root '];然后

19、回声'请以根用户身份重新运行basename $ '

20、出口/p

21、船方不负担装货费用

22、船方不负担装货费用

23、#==================检查当前用户开始===================

24、如果[!$ USER=root];然后

25、回应"请以根用户身份重新运行此脚本。"

26、出口/p

27、船方不负担装货费用

28、#==================检查当前用户end================

29、#!/bin/sh

30、如果id | grep '^uid=root)'/dev/null;然后

31、回声是根

32、其他

33、回声不是根

34、船方不负担装货费用

35、check _ user(){ 0

36、if[$ UID-ne];然后

37、回应"当前用户不是根用户。"

38、回应"请以根用户身份重新运行安装程序。"

39、出口/p

40、船方不负担装货费用

本文到此结束,希望对大家有所帮助。

免责声明:本文由用户上传,如有侵权请联系删除!